The expedition included Artemis 2 moon astronaut Jeremy Hansen, with the Canadian House Company, and NASA astronaut Christina Koch. The 2 shall be mission specialists aboard Artemis 2, the primary moon mission to ship people round our neighboring satellite tv for pc since 1972.

Whereas Hansen and Koch is not going to be touchdown on the moon, geology coaching will help them with recognizing options like craters from afar. House businesses around the globe usually run geology journeys akin to this to assist astronauts hone their abilities within the subject, in addition to learn to work in groups in rugged circumstances.

Noting that the expedition went to part of the crater that he by no means visited earlier than, journey chief and planetary scientist Gordon Osinski (of Western College in Canada) referred to as the tour “true exploration” on X. “What discoveries we made,” he added within the Sept. 5 publish, “reminding us of how Kamestastin is such a novel analogue for the moon.”

Becoming a member of Hansen and Koch on the expedition have been CSA astronaut Jenni Sidey-Gibbons and NASA’s Raja Chari. Chari and Sidey-Gibbons have been each chosen as astronauts in 2017 and are eligible for future mission assignments. Apart from which, working with Hansen instantly was a callback to their coaching. Hansen was the first-ever non-American answerable for managing an astronaut candidate class’ coaching schedule, which incorporates mentoring the brand new recruits.

Their vacation spot was the crater Kamestastin (often known as Mistastin) in northern Labrador, one among simply 31 craters shaped by meteorites in Canada, according to CSA documentation. The crater shares options with others which are current on the moon, akin to anorthosite, a typical rock on the south pole the place future Artemis program missions will land.

“This website is especially particular not solely due to the influence itself, however due to the goal rock the asteroid hit,” Sidey-Gibbons wrote on Instagram. “By studying the way to gather samples and establish options right here, we’re studying how astronauts might establish essentially the most scientifically wealthy samples to return on a lunar mission.”

Osinski shared his appreciable lunar expertise with the group as properly. The planetary scientist is taken into account one of many prime crater specialists in Canada, calling himself “Dr. Crater” on X. He’s a principal investigator of Canada’s anticipated mini rover on the moon, which is able to launch in 2026 or so utilizing {hardware} from aerospace firm Canadensys.

Osinski, often known as “Oz” to colleagues, shall be one of many geologists working instantly with the Artemis 3 touchdown crew, which is able to land on the moon’s floor no sooner than 2025 or 2026. He’s additionally an everyday a part of NASA astronaut candidate coaching, specializing in geology.

Hansen, who has made quite a few journeys with Osinski, was just lately credited in a peer-reviewed paper by which Osinski and the crew on a 2011 tour discovered a really uncommon kind of crater in Saskatchewan, Canada. The transitional crater at Gow Lake, whose kind was reclassified scientifically after the crew’s work, is barely recognized in a single different location on Earth: Goat Paddock in northwestern Australia.
